The Story of Jordyn
Jordyn is a modern variant spelling of Jordan, which derives from the Hebrew Yarden, meaning to flow down or descend. The name originally referred to the Jordan River, one of the most historically and religiously significant waterways in the world, flowing from the Sea of Galilee south to the Dead Sea. The Y-spelling gives it a contemporary flair while maintaining the name's rich heritage.
The Jordan/Jordyn spelling gained popularity in the 1990s, heavily influenced by basketball legend Michael Jordan. The variant Jordyn with a Y emerged as parents sought a distinctive feminine or gender-neutral spelling, peaking in the 2000s-2010s.
The Jordan River holds sacred significance in Judaism, Christianity, and Islam. In Christian tradition, Jesus was baptized in the Jordan River, lending the name deep spiritual weight. In modern American culture, the name is associated with athletic excellence through Michael Jordan.

Jordyn is a boy name with American, English, and African American origins . The name means "flowing down, descend" in Hebrew .
Is Jordyn a boy or girl name? Jordyn is used as both a boy and girl name. As a boy name, it ranks #2,068 in popularity. As a girl name, it ranks #328. Jordyn is more commonly used as a girl name.
